The Geiger-Mueller (GM) detectors fulfill a wide variety of radiation measurement needs. Probes are available for detection of alpha, beta, and gamma radiation. Some probes are provided with a 360° shield to permit discrimination between penetrating and non-penetrating radiation.

Reliability and ruggedness are built into the GM detectors, with uniformity of construction and field-proven design to assure dependable performance with all the GM survey instruments. Standard MHV type connectors readily allow interchange of all detector probes. The GM counters are fastened to the Model 190 Count Rate and Survey Meter by a Velcro® strap. The life expectancy of the counters ranges from 108 total counts to unlimited life depending on the type of quench gas utilized. Enhanced sensitivity to low-level alpha, beta, gamma and x-ray radiation is achieved when using the unique Model 498-110D Pancake GM Probe.

The scintillation detectors are carefully selected and optically coupled to photomultiplier tubes. The photomultipliers are magnetically shielded with mu-metal and specially shock mounted to provide trouble-free performance. The entire detector, crystal and photomultiplier, are secured in sturdy, cylindrical, aluminum housing. Where appropriate, a thin window has been utilized to provide alpha or low energy gamma response

The GM probes provide a qualitative assessment for radiation detection. The following probe selection guide lists various probes and suggested applications. Applications include nuclear medicine counter top surveys, leakage detection from diagnostic x-ray and linear accelerators, geological surveys, scrap metal yards and unknown wells

The scintillation detectors provide a quantitative assessment for radiation detection in counts/minutes. Applications outlined in this guide include nuclear medicine labs, HAZMAT spills, radiation safety office surveys, industrial hygiene, industrial x-ray manufacturing, and geological surveys.

Specifications

Product Specifications
Type:
 NaI (Tl) Sodium Iodide 1.5 x 1.5, scintillator optically coupled to PMT
Radiation detected:
 Gamma and x-ray above 60 keV
Applications:
 • Nuclear medicine
 • Industrial hygiene
 • Industrial x-ray manufacturing
 • Geological surveys
 • Radiation safety office
Typical background (CPM):
 5000
Nominal sensitivity:
 350,000 CPM/mR/hr 137Cs
Wall material:
 0.04 in Al, 1 mm thick
Window:
 108 mg/cm2 Al
Sensitive area:
 11.4 cm2
Crystal dim.:
 1.5 x 1.5 in
Probe diameter:
 2 in
Probe length:
 9.125 in
Cable length:
 48 in
Operating voltage:
 900 V
Calibration:
 137 Cs 2 pts/scale to 5 mR/hr
Cal. Tolerance:
 ± 10%
Efficiency:
 137Cs 13%
Humidity range:
 0 to 95%
Operating temp:
 – 40° to + 120°F; – 40° to + 50°C; Max. temp increase of 20°F/hr
Weight (approx.):
 1.5 lb (0.68 kg)
